This is a simple demonstration of Affetto, a child android robot developed at Osaka University in Japan. In this movie, Affetto shows wincing faces when the amplitude of the input signal added onto a tactile sensor exceeds a threshold. Simply that's it in the robot. Our focus is on how we recognize this situation and treat the robot looks like having the capability of feeling pain.
